Fox kit 0-730 loves the old stories about Mia and Uly and hungers
for a life filled with adventure. But on the Farm, foxes know only
the safety of their wire dens. When O-370 slips free of his cage,
he witnesses the gruesome reality awaiting all of the Farm's foxes
and narrowly escapes with his life. In a nearby suburb, young Cozy
and her skulk are facing an unknown danger, a being that can blend
in with the scenery and can speak with a fox's voice. Something
that hunts foxes. Forced to flee their den, they travel to a
terrifying new world: the City. There, Cozy and O-370's lives will
intersect, and they'll need to stick together if they're to survive
the monsters that lurk among the City's shadows. And they'll
quickly discover that there are no cautionary tales to prepare them
for the most dangerous creatures of all: humans.

British comedy starring Dakota Blue Richards, Christian McKay and
Miles Jupp. When a group of men face the daunting prospect of
finding a new local pub after theirs is threatened with closure,
they pool together to figure out a way to raise enough cash to save
the pub. When they decide to write a novel based on the popular
'mummy porn' genre, they contact a publisher (Eileen Atkins),
pretending to be the author's agents, who agrees to publish the
book on the condition that the author commit herself to a book
tour. Desperate for the deal to go through, David (McKay) asks his
sister-in-law Zoe (Richards) to pretend to be the author of their
prospective best-seller for the sake of the press. All goes to plan
until a studio buys the film rights and asks Zoe to play the
lead...

Ron Howard directs this biographical drama chronicling the intense
rivalry between Formula 1 drivers James Hunt (Chris Hemsworth) and
Niki Lauda (Daniel Brühl) during the 1976 season. Polar opposites
both on and off the track, the rancour between dashing,
devil-may-care British playboy Hunt and the efficient and cool
Austrian Lauda knows no bounds as the two battle it out to be the
1976 Formula 1 World Champion. But when a horrifying crash at
Germany's Nürburgring leaves Lauda badly burned and scarred, his
miraculous return to the track in just six weeks earns the grudging
respect of Hunt, in the process setting up a climactic end to the
season as both drivers pursue the ultimate prize.
